Understanding Your Audience: The Key to Success
To achieve a solid return on investment from Facebook ads, you must first delve into the psyche of your potential customers. This means developing buyer personas that encapsulate your target audience's traits, preferences, and behaviors. According to recent studies, specifically tailored ads can increase your click-through rate (CTR) significantly, from averages of 0.20% to potentially 3% when ads resonate more closely with user needs. Utilize tools from Hubspot and Buffer to create compelling personas that help target your campaigns effectively.
Creating Urgency and Value
Given that Facebook users often engage for social reasons rather than shopping, offering incentives can help prompt action. Highlighting limited-time offers or exclusive discounts ignites urgency among shoppers. Phrases such as "last chance" or "limited availability" can nudge hesitant buyers toward conversion. Additionally, consider reformulating your ad copy based on the AIDA model: Attention, Interest, Desire, and Action. A well-structured ad that appeals directly to the user's needs can capture interest immediately.
Targeting & Re-targeting: The Hidden Goldmine
Remarketing is an underutilized strategy that can significantly boost revenues. After engaging users who have visited your product page but didn’t purchase, tailored follow-up ads can effectively convert them into paying customers. For example, ads aimed at users who've abandoned their carts should remind them of the products they left behind, perhaps with an attractive discount to sweeten the deal.
Integrating Your Facebook Ads with Content Marketing
Content marketing and Facebook advertising are powerful allies. Create informative, entertaining content that addresses customer pain points, then promote it using Facebook ads segmented by the stage of the sales funnel. This not only keeps your audience engaged at various touchpoints but also positions your brand as a thought leader, making them more likely to convert when they see your product ads.
